2. The Cooperative, Acting as an Umbrella.

Asmara shall apply/register, through wholly-owned subsidiary company, for requisite licences to conduct business under which sub-licences or sub-contracts could be distributed to members and/or members’ business firms; provided that they have the relevant skills, know-how, technology, and experience. Among the relevant licences that we may possess are, but not limited to:

  • PKK "Bumiputra" Company

  • CIDB Licensed Contractor

  • Registered Contractor/Supplier in the panel of GLCs, Government Agencies or Ministries such as:
    • Petronas

    • TNB

    • TMB/Celcom

    • Malaysia Airlines

    • Malaysia Airports

    • UEM

    • JBA/Syabas/PUAS/SAJ

    • MRCB
    • FELDA/FELCRA

    • MARA

    • JKR/DBKL

    • MoF/MoE/MoH/MoD


3 To Set up a Corporate Agency for maximizing e-business Platforms.


At the start, a division will have to be established to handle insurance schemes with products that are specially-rated and designed for its members. The advent of IT and the introduction of e-covernote and e-pay systems will facilitate the setting-up and management of this scheme. Members shall be drawn to purchase their insurance needs through the cooperative.
